HP ENVY 750-427c
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

Hello, earlier this afternoon I hopped on my computer and began to go about my day around 10 minutes after turning my computer my clumsy hand knocked over a glass of water that spilled onto the top of my desktop which is under my desk and some slight water got onto the cords that go into my computer but not something drastic. 

A few minutes later I was cleaning it up and my desktop power button began to flash white but with a sequence of beeps meaning something was wrong so I decided to shut the computer completely off. I then rebooted the computer and it seemed to be fine once more, it was checking my drives and such and then it took me to this old looking screen which prompted me to “repair/install windows” which I clicked on repair and I let it sit there for around 20 minutes and it didn’t realistically do anything so I decided to shut my PC off. I tried once more and instead of slightly turning on and bringing me to a normal screen it would not display anything on my monitor and it would rather just beep the same sequence from earlier. 3 long beeps with the flashing power button then the 2 short beeps following that. It would then stop after awhile but would still be flashing the white power button symbol. Any ideas of how can I fix/repair this?
